Step 1: Identify the Problem
The first step in 4 Steps To Rescue Your Ruined Excel Files is to identify the problem. This involves a thorough examination of the affected file, including its structure, data, and formatting. By understanding the nature of the damage, you'll be able to develop an effective recovery plan.
Some common causes of ruined Excel files include:
- Corruption during software updates
- Hardware failures or data loss
- Human error or data entry mistakes
- Malware or virus attacks
Step 2: Choose the Right Tools
With the problem identified, it's time to choose the right tools for the job. This may involve installing data recovery software, such as Ontrack Data Recovery or Recuva, or using manual editing techniques, such as Excel's built-in repair tools.
When selecting data recovery software, it's essential to consider the following factors:
- Recovery rate: Look for software with a high recovery rate and the ability to recover multiple file types.
- Ease of use: Choose software with a user-friendly interface and minimal technical requirements.
- Data integrity: Select software that preserves data integrity and prevents further corruption.
Step 3: Recover the Data
With the right tools in place, it's time to recover the data. This involves using the data recovery software to scan the affected file, identify recoverable data, and extract it from the corrupted file.
Some common data recovery techniques include:
- File repair: Repairing damaged files using Excel's built-in tools or data recovery software.
- Data extraction: Extracting specific data from the corrupted file using manual editing techniques or data recovery software.
- Data migration: Migrating data from the corrupted file to a new, untouched location.
